Spring is just around the corner, and IKEA has just added a collection of fresh and inspiring new lamps and accessories that will freshen up your home office in time for the brighter days ahead. Add a splash of green with maintenance-free artificial plants, and you'll have a space that's as calming as a stroll through a woodland glade (almost).
As one of TechRadar's homes editors, I'm always on the lookout for smart and stylish lighting that will brighten up a workspace. I'm waiting impatiently for the official launch of the donut-shaped IKEA Varmblixt Lamp, which cycles through a palette of soothing colors, but until then you can add a natural touch with the Storsegel Table Lamp in ash, or IKEA's range of Sandkorn / Havsdjup Pendant Lamps, which feature hand-crafted rattan shades in a range of shapes.
You can soften the look further by nestling your tablet or laptop on the bamboo Vivalla Tablet Stand, and setting your phone down on the Bergenes Mobile Phone / Tablet Holder, so you won't be tempted to start doom-scrolling. Want something more fun? The Handskalad Decoration is an articulated wooden hand that can hang onto your phone while you get on with work.
Throw in a few Fejka Artificial Potted Plants and pin a few of your favorite nature photos to the Skådis Pegboard, and you'll have a fresh and welcoming space that'll help you relax into your working day.
